HTML कैनवास createPattern () विधि
उपयोग करने के लिए छवि:
उदाहरण
एक छवि को क्षैतिज और लंबवत दोनों तरह से दोहराएं:
जावास्क्रिप्ट:
var c = document.getElementById("myCanvas");
var ctx = c.getContext("2d");
var img = document.getElementById("lamp");
var pat = ctx.createPattern(img, "repeat");
ctx.rect(0, 0, 150, 100);
ctx.fillStyle = pat;
ctx.fill();
ब्राउज़र समर्थन
तालिका में संख्याएं पहले ब्राउज़र संस्करण को निर्दिष्ट करती हैं जो पूरी तरह से विधि का समर्थन करता है।
Method | |||||
---|---|---|---|---|---|
createPattern() | Yes | 9.0 | Yes | Yes | Yes |
परिभाषा और उपयोग
createPattern () विधि निर्दिष्ट दिशा में निर्दिष्ट तत्व को दोहराती है।
तत्व एक छवि, वीडियो या कोई अन्य <कैनवास> तत्व हो सकता है।
दोहराए गए तत्व का उपयोग आयतों, वृत्तों, रेखाओं आदि को खींचने/भरने के लिए किया जा सकता है।
जावास्क्रिप्ट सिंटैक्स: | संदर्भ । createPattern ( छवि , "दोहराना | दोहराना-एक्स | दोहराना-वाई | नहीं-दोहराना"); |
---|
पैरामीटर मान
Parameter | Description | Play it |
---|---|---|
image | Specifies the image, canvas, or video element of the pattern to use | |
repeat | Default. The pattern repeats both horizontally and vertically | |
repeat-x | The pattern repeats only horizontally | |
repeat-y | The pattern repeats only vertically | |
no-repeat | The pattern will be displayed only once (no repeat) |
❮ HTML कैनवास संदर्भ